Action item PS-7 (owner: Darla Venn, platform team): the Inkroute spooler microservice accepted print jobs over an unauthenticated internal endpoint, which contributed to the queue flooding during the incident. We will add mutual TLS between the spooler and its submitters and rate-limit per client. Security review is requested before the change ships, since the spooler handles documents from the finance enclave. The threat model and proposed endpoint changes are documented on this page:

wiki page, tahaf-tajog: https://jira.ordindyn.corp/pipeline

Hey Marit — handing over the Flickergrid transcode farm before I rotate onto the Pondwright launch. The workers pull jobs from the Quillbeam queue and fan out across the render pool; nothing exotic, but watch the GPU nodes in the Askeholm rack, they overheat if you push 4K jobs past six concurrent. Restarts are safe mid-job since chunks checkpoint every 30 seconds. Logs go to the usual place. Everything the farm needs at boot is listed in the block below.

deployment values, yadug-bawif:
[framir]
team = pelox
access_code = ac_a38ab2
owner = tamion.julael
host = framir.tolvaqlabs.test
port = 11211
peer = tammir.zemvargrid.local
salt = 2215ef03
pin = 1541

Status: locale-aware formatting shipped for the Pelligro dashboard; invoices still pending. Known issues: week-start logic hardcoded to Monday, breaks for three locales; relative dates ("2 days ago") not yet translated. Do not touch the legacy formatter in `datekit/old` — two report jobs still depend on its quirks. Next steps: migrate invoice templates, then delete the legacy path. Test fixtures cover 14 locales; add yours before merging. Full context, open tickets, and the locale matrix are on the internal tracking page.

runbook for badug-kadup: https://confluence.zemvarlabs.internal/projects/browse/display/projects/bd1b